    In the first round of the Champions League group stage, Slavia Prague hosts Lens. Slavia Prague, a Czech powerhouse, has a strong offensive in the domestic league. Their home - field performance is dominant with a continuous offensive threat, and their strikers are in good form. However, they have mediocre performances in European competitions. They've failed to win in several recent European matches, showing a lack of experience in this arena. On the other hand, Lens, a top team in Ligue 1 and the runner - up of the league last season, has a better - assembled squad. They have an advantage in terms of the overall squad value. But their away - game performances are inconsistent, and their European away - game record is just average. As the two teams' strengths are comparable, the home - field advantage might be the key factor. The match could be a close one. The team that scores first will have a better chance to take control. The ability to control the rhythm and seize key moments will determine the outcome. It'll be interesting to see if Slavia Prague can break their European losing streak with home - field support, or if Lens can secure a result on the road.
